How to Choose the Best Running Club Names

Before we get to the list, here’s a quick checklist for choosing the perfect name:

✔ Keep It Short

Short names are easier to chant, print, or hashtag.

Advertisements

✔ Make It Personal

Names based on inside jokes, your town, or your goals feel more connected.

✔ Think About the Vibe

Are you casual or competitive? Funny or focused?

Advertisements

✔ Avoid Overused Words

Everyone uses “Run,” “Sprint,” and “Fast.” Mix it up.

Quick Tips for Using Your Running Club Name

Once you pick the perfect name, here’s what to do with it:

  • Make a logo using free tools like Canva

  • Print it on shirts, caps, or bibs

  • Create a group on WhatsApp or Strava

  • Use it as a hashtag on Instagram

  • Turn it into a slogan or chant

  • Register it for a local event if you’re serious about branding

FAQs About Running Club Names

How many words should a running club name be?

Ideally, 2 to 4 words. Shorter names are easier to say, remember, and print.

Advertisements

Can we reuse a name we found online?

Yes, unless it’s a registered trademark. But you can always tweak it to make it unique.


Should we pick a serious or funny name?

Depends on your team vibe. Fun names work great for casual groups. Serious names are better for competitive teams.

Advertisements

Can we change our running club name later?

Absolutely. Many clubs do this when their group grows or shifts focus.


Is it okay to include a sponsor in our club name?

Yes, but keep it tasteful. Something like “Greenway Runners by FitLife Gym” works well.
